The Power Stroke: The basic paddle technique is a forward stroke. Place the blade in the water near your toes. Pull the blade back alongside the kayak approximately to your hip–a better way to think of it is pulling the kayak up to the blade. Lift the paddle and perform the same move on the other side. To turn the kayak, use a wide sweep stroke on one side. The bow will swing away from the stroke.

The Efficient Stroke: For greater efficiency use your torso and shoulders to paddle, not just your arms. Make sure to sit up straight to avoid straining your back.

How to Paddle A CANOE The Paddle: Place your upper hand

over the top grip. With your lower hand, grip the shaft about a foot above the blade/shaft intersection. Remember

holding the shaft closer to the blade only makes you work harder with each stroke.

The Power Stroke: A strong stroke is the fundamental tool of canoeing. To begin rotate your torso so that your paddle-side shoulder is forward. At the same time, plant your blade in the water up to the blade/shaft intersection. The blade should be kept close to the boat, with its inside edge just touching the side of the canoe. The shaft should be vertical. Your strongest stroke will utilize the full forward range of your torso/shoulder rotation, yet keep the shaft absolutely vertical. Your stroke ends when your torso rotation brings the paddle back to your hip. Paddle re- covery is now a straight-forward matter: rotate your torso to put your paddle- side shoulder forward while bringing the paddle over the water surface to begin the next stroke.

The Efficient Stroke: The thrust of your stroke is achieved by rotating your torso rather than pulling with your arms. Using your torso muscles distrib- utes the work to many muscles rather than a few, making your stroke both powerful and efficient. The results: more forward thrust and less fatigue.

One of the hallmark features of Ocean Kayaks is their stability. The kayaks are built with a wide hull design that provides impressive initial and secondary stability. This makes them particularly suitable for beginners looking to gain confidence on the water, as well as for experienced paddlers who prefer a stable platform for recreational or fishing activities.

Ocean Kayaks are constructed using durable polyethylene material, which ensures robustness while remaining lightweight. This durability means that the kayaks can withstand bumps and scrapes during transport and launch, making them ideal for coastal and rugged environments. Additionally, many models feature a comfortable seating system, providing excellent back support and cushioning for extended paddling sessions.

Another key aspect of Ocean Kayaks is their versatility. The brand offers a variety of models tailored for different purposes, including sit-on-top, touring, and fishing kayaks. Sit-on-top models, for example, are exceptionally user-friendly and allow for easy entry and exit, making them perfect for warm-weather outings. For fishing enthusiasts, Ocean Kayak integrates rod holders, tackle storage, and ample deck space, creating an ideal setup for a day on the water.

In terms of technology, Ocean Kayak incorporates features such as the Comfort Plus seat back, which is adjustable and provides enhanced lumbar support. The kayaks also have built-in carry handles, making transportation more convenient. Some models come equipped with a rudder system, improving control and navigation in windy conditions or strong currents.

Moreover, Ocean Kayaks are designed with ample storage options, including forward and rear tank wells and bungee cords, allowing paddlers to secure gear safely. This practicality ensures that everything needed for a day out on the water is stowed securely.
